用drawtext函数将一段文字显示在paintbox中,在2000下显示正常,而98下怎么变得这么大?为什么呀。。?
是字体的原因还是怎么了?惨不忍睹了。
是字体的原因还是怎么了?惨不忍睹了。
解决方案 »
- DELPHI中,用ADOQUERY1作数据源,用DBGRID呈现数据,如何感应到DBGRID中的数据已经改变?
- CoolTrayIcon 的一些问题和其他综合性问题。
- 过年了,送分!!
- 如何获知 TListView的 Column宽度发生了变化?请各位大侠帮忙了
- 截取函数使用啊!
- 小弟初学DELPHI与数据库关联,ADO+ACCESS,提示说"from子句语法错误"
- 郁闷ing,散20分,凑个整数。
- 关于property的问题?
- ini文件操作-急 急 急!!!!!!!
- ORA-12571:TNS:包写入程序失败。??????
- 十万火急:用ClientDataSet1组件将数据存入oracle中出错
- 界面、功能极其相似的表单如何重复利用
为什么呀。。?
是字体的原因还是怎么了?惨不忍睹了。
--------------------------------
ViewPaintBox.Canvas.Brush.Color := Color.BColor; //clWhite
ViewPaintBox.Canvas.Font.Color := Color.FColor;
ViewPaintBox.Canvas.TextOut(X, Y, S);
ViewPaintBox是TPaintBox类型的。
放在一个Panel上。
在98下form变大,字体好像也大了画出来的效果同2000相差太大。。?
怎么办?